溫馨提示×

java hessian與JSON比較的結果

小樊
94
2024-07-16 04:52:51
欄目: 編程語言

Hessian是一種用于序列化和反序列化Java對象的輕量級二進制協(xié)議,而JSON是一種用于數(shù)據(jù)交換的文本格式。以下是Hessian和JSON之間的一些比較結果:

  1. 性能:Hessian比JSON更快,因為Hessian使用二進制格式,而JSON使用文本格式。這使得Hessian在網(wǎng)絡傳輸和數(shù)據(jù)解析方面更高效。

  2. 體積:由于Hessian使用二進制格式,它比JSON在數(shù)據(jù)傳輸時占用更少的帶寬和存儲空間。

  3. 可讀性:JSON比Hessian更容易閱讀和理解,因為JSON使用人類可讀的文本格式,而Hessian使用二進制格式。

  4. 跨平臺支持:JSON在各種編程語言和平臺上都有很好的支持,而Hessian主要用于Java。

綜上所述,選擇Hessian還是JSON取決于具體的應用場景和需求。如果對性能和數(shù)據(jù)大小有較高要求,可以選擇Hessian。如果需要更好的可讀性和跨平臺支持,可以選擇JSON。

0